tony gonzalez-3-831x1024Anthony David Gonzalez was born on February 27, 1976. He is an American football tight end. He played for 17 seasons with the National Football League. Gonzalez is regarded as one of the top tight ends to ever play, and is currently the NFL's most efficient tight end, in terms of receiving yards and receptions for tight ends. Gonzalez is third in the number of receptions he has. Gonzalez's first 12 seasons associated with the Kansas City Chiefs. In 1997, he received a selection as the 1st pick. In the five seasons that followed, he was with the Atlanta Falcons. Since his retirement in 2013, Gonzalez has been an analyst on football for NFL on Prime Video and previously worked at CBS Sports and Fox Sports.Gonzalez completed his career with 14 Pro Bowl selections, the most for a tightend and second-most in league history and also received six first-team All-Pros. Gonzalez was well-known for his strength and his ability to not throw a ball. He played in 272 games during the regular season and only fumbled twice, on 1,327 touches. In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ame Gonzalez was inducted in the year 2019.
